P2P

Service

OSNTELECOM makes it easier for network subscribers to send and receive short text messages between several different Network Operators allocated in various countries and destinations via our P2P SMS service. This service is executed via two-way SMS hubbing connectivity and aims at improving connections between global MNOs by managing all technical and physical implementations, along with reporting activities of SMS traffic flow. Having a direct connectivity to a great number of MNOs and trusted international SMS hubbing parties all over the globe, OSNTELECOM paves the way for easier, more efficient and better handling of your two-way SMS traffic via our SMPP Peer-to-Peer offered service.

What is a cookie?

A cookie is a small text file that is stored on your computer or other internet connected device in order to identify your browser, provide analytics, remember information about you such as your language preference or login information. They're completely safe and can't be used to run programs or deliver viruses to your device.

What type of cookies does On Speed Network use?

Cookies can either be session cookies or persistent cookies. A session cookie expires automatically when you close your browser. A persistent cookie will remain until it expires or you delete your cookies. Expiration dates are set in the cookies themselves; some may expire after a few minutes while others may expire after multiple years. Cookies placed by the website you’re visiting are called “first party cookies”.
Strictly Necessary cookies are necessary for our website to function and cannot be switched off in our systems. They are essential in order to enable you to navigate around the website and use its features. If you remove or disable these cookies, we cannot guarantee that you will be able to use our website.
